Abstract
Pediatric inguinal hernias and hydroceles are due to incomplete or abn ormal obliteration of the processus vaginalis. Surgical correction of these conditions is the most common surgical procedure performed on yo ung children. The embryology, anatomy, evaluation, and management of p ediatric inguinal hernias and hydroceles are reviewed. A thorough unde rstanding of these topics will aid with the sometimes difficult decisi ons encountered in the care of these patients.
